📌 I. Product Definition & Classification: What is "Natural Rubber Foam"?

Natural Rubber Foam, technically referred to in customs terminology as "Cellular Rubber of Natural Rubber," is not a single commodity but a base material state. Its HS Code classification depends entirely on the final application and specific use case of the article.

In international trade, "Cellular Rubber" (Foam) is treated differently from solid rubber. It includes products with open or closed cells, such as mats, vibration dampeners, cushions, and mattress cores.

⚠️ Key Distinction:
- If the product is raw foam sheets/blocks or generic parts → Often falls under 4016.
- If the product is a finished consumer good (like a mattress or cushion) → Falls under Chapter 94.
- "Hard Rubber" (Ebonite) is excluded. This guide only covers vulcanized cellular rubber.


📦 II. HS Code Classification Details (2026 Latest Tariff Authority Match)

Based on the provided data, Natural Rubber Foam is classified into two main categories: General Rubber Articles and Bedding/Furnishing.

HS Code Product Description Application Scenario Material State
4016.10.00.00 Other articles of vulcanized rubber other than hard rubber: Of cellular rubber Generic foam parts, gaskets, mats, industrial liners, raw foam sheets (if not specified as bedding) ✅ Cellular (Foam)
4016.99.30.00 Other articles of vulcanized rubber other than hard rubber: Other: Other: Of natural rubber: Vibration control goods of a kind used in the vehicles of headings 8701 through 8705 Auto vibration dampeners, engine mounts, rubber foam bushings for trucks/cars ✅ Cellular (Foam)
9404.21.00.13 Mattress supports; articles of bedding...: Mattresses: Of cellular rubber or plastics... Of a width exceeding 91 cm, length exceeding 184 cm, and depth exceeding 8 cm Large foam mattresses (King/Queen size standard dimensions) ✅ Cellular (Foam)
9404.90.96.36 Mattress supports; articles of bedding...: Other: Other: Other With outer shell of other textile materials: Other Foam cushions, pillows, pouffes, or non-mattress foam bedding items with textile covers ✅ Cellular (Foam)

🔍 Critical Note:
- General Foam Parts: If the natural rubber foam is used for industrial purposes (not bedding, not auto parts), it falls under 4016.10.00.00.
- Auto Parts: If specifically for vehicle vibration control, it has a dedicated sub-category under 4016.99.30.00.
- Bedding: If it's a mattress or cushion, it must be declared under Chapter 94, not Chapter 40. Misclassification here leads to severe penalties.

🛠️ IV. Clearance Practical Advice (Real-World Pitfall Guide)

✅ 1. Document Checklist (Must-Haves)

Document Required? Explanation
Product Spec Sheet ✔️ Must clearly state "Natural Rubber Foam" or "Cellular Rubber".
Material Composition ✔️ Proof that it is Natural Rubber (not Synthetic/SBR/Neoprene). Synthetic foam may have different 301 rates.
Dimensions List ✔️ Critical for Mattresses/Cushions. If you declare 9404.21, you must prove dimensions > 91x184x8 cm.
Usage Declaration ✔️ For 4016.99.30.00, you must declare "For Vehicle Vibration Control". Provide OEM drawings if possible.
Commercial Invoice ✔️ Description must match HS Code precisely (e.g., "Natural Rubber Foam Mattress, King Size").
Packing List ✔️ Show individual items clearly. Do not mix auto parts with bedding.

✅ 2. Classification Strategy (Key Rules)

🔥 "Use Defines HS Code: Auto Parts are Rubber, Bedding is Furnishing!"

Scenario Correct HS Code Risk if Wrong
Auto Vibration Dampener 4016.99.30.00 If declared as general rubber (4016.99), still 25%, but audit risk increases.
Generic Foam Sheet/Gasket 4016.10.00.00 If declared as mattress, rejected.
Foam Mattress (Large) 9404.21.00.13 0% Tariff. Do not declare as 4016 (25% Tariff)! Huge savings.
Foam Pillow (Textile Cover) 9404.90.96.36 0% Tariff. Do not declare as 4016 (25% Tariff)!
Foam Pillow (No Cover/Exposed) Likely 4016.99.99 or similar May incur 25% tariff.

✅ 3. Special Case Handling

Situation Handling Advice
Mixed Shipment (Auto Parts + Mattresses) DO NOT MIX. Declare separately. Mixing causes customs hold and reclassification.
Synthetic vs. Natural Rubber If the foam is Synthetic (e.g., SBR, NBR), it may NOT qualify for 4016.99.30.00 (which specifies "Of natural rubber"). It would fall under 4016.99.99 or other subheadings, potentially with higher 301 tariffs.
Mattress Dimensions Slightly Smaller If width < 91 cm, 9404.21.00.13 is invalid. Check other 9404.21 subheadings. Some may have 0% or low rates; others may have higher.
"Other" Bedding Items If it’s a foam toy or non-bedding item, it does not qualify for Chapter 94 0% rates. It falls back to Chapter 40 (25%).

协调制度(HS)是由世界海关组织(WCO)制定的国际贸易商品分类标准。全球 200 多个国家采用 HS 系统作为海关关税、贸易统计和进出口监管的基础。

每个 HS 编码遵循以下层级结构:

  • 章(2 位)——商品大类(例如:第 84 章:机器和机械设备)
  • 品目(4 位)——章内的更具体分类
  • 子目(6 位)——国际通用细分,所有 WCO 成员国统一使用
  • 本国细分(8-10 位)——各国自行扩展的细分编码,如美国 HTSUS 10 位编码

正确的 HS 编码归类对于顺利通关、准确缴纳关税和遵守贸易法规至关重要。错误归类可能导致海关延误、多缴关税或罚款。
